To keep fueled when you're breastfeeding twins, you'll need 450 to … WebApr 11, 2024 · On average, most exclusively breastfed. alert icon. babies will feed about every 2 to 4 hours. Some babies may feed as often as every hour at times, often called cluster feeding. Or may have a longer sleep interval of 4 to 5 hours. WebApr 19, 2024 · It's good for moms, too, reducing their risk of breast and ovarian cancer, Type 2 diabetes and high blood pressure. Breastfeeding is a learning experience for mother and baby. It's a natural activity, but it takes practice, which requires time and patience. Feeding sessions can take 30 minutes or longer, especially in the beginning. WebSep 1, 2024 · Hold your infant’s head in the hand that will be feeding them (i.e., if nursing from the right breast, hold the head with your left hand). Place your wrist between your child’s shoulder blades, your thumb behind one ear, and your other fingers behind the other. Allow your baby’s natural mobility by cradling his neck. WebJun 1, 2024 · You'll want to plan on pumping about 8 times per day. You should pump every 2 to 3 hours during the day, and every 3 to 4 hours at night (or during work). Pump well: If you are breastfeeding a premature baby, your hospital should loan you a medical-grade breast pump.
